Debating in the topic is making me believe that Bitcoin and Gold will both be occupying their own small niches in society. Most normal, working people won't be buying Bitcoin, or Gold, because most normal, working people don't save to invest with their salaries.

In my country (India), gold is the most popular form of investment asset (perhaps along with land). Gold is not very volatile and not much paperwork is needed for purchasing gold coins or jewelry. On the other hand, in case you want to purchase equities, ETFs or mutual funds, then you need a demat account and filing tax returns may also get complicated.
Neither does bitcoin requires many paper work also to purchase bitcoin and have it as an asset, the only difference between gold and bitcoin is that bitcoin has a higher volatility, which to me is even of a great advantage when the price of bitcoin shoots up, it could shoot so high and give profit that no gold investment can ever give.

The advantage of gold to me is that the value is quite stable and could service as reliable means of exchange and payment for a particular services or goods and will still have the same value of what the purchase is worth. Gold is older than bitcoin, and that is the reason why it is more popular, the moment bitcoin get older and the volatility reduces, it will be nearing what gold also is to people and even more.

I believe it will in the end.
However it won't in a near future.

Notice this, gold could have some 2nd layer networks built upon which may solve those inconveniences of physical gold.
But there is a cripple point that none of those networks could be pegged to physical gold by code or I should say a decentralised method.

On the other hand, we could build 2nd layer pegged with bitcoin by code (Lightning for example).
We can also build an alternative 2nd layer pegged with bitcoin by builder's credibility (Bitpay for example).The latter one is just like gold's 2nd layer.

Which of these two kinds is more popular? If the answer is the latter one, then bitcoin won't replace gold at all.

I d be happy BitCoin will replace any PM like Gold & Silver any time soon.

Think of all that crap the digging & chemistry it does to mother nature - mining BitCoin could be done with sustainable sources. [b2But to get a real use case, BitCoin must scale[/b]


Yes it must, but not in the direction the big blockers took. Bitcoin's value-proposition is in its decentralization. From it, came censorship-resistance, and security. Giving up decentralization to make it "scale up" would be a bad decision, and reduces its primary value-proposition. Decentralization, censorship-resistance, security.

What Bitcoin Core developers should do is improve latency, to make it scale out, make it easier for new nodes to do the initial blockchain download.
